Vessel 30 - Apparently part of a large rolled rim in a fabric 6-7mm containing a moderate amount of angular quartz grains (fabric 6). The internal and external surfaces are reddish-yellow (5YR 6/6) to black in colour.
Site Name: Gwernvale, Crickhowell
Notes: All sherds of vessel 30 were found within a radius of about 2m near the entrance to Chamber 3 within layers belonging to the final blocking of both the chamber and the cairn. The sherds may have been residual finds incoperated within the blocking material.
